1. High-Intensity Interval Training
High-Intensity Interval Training, or HIIT, takes your exercise to an entire new level. It has actually gotten appeal because it offers impressive health and fitness leads to a shorter amount of time than traditional cardio exercises.

HIIT includes alternating in between brief periods of high-intensity exercise and low-intensity recuperation. It can be done with practically any sort of task, including running, biking, utilizing a rowing device or even bodyweight workouts such as jump squats and burpees. Each round or "repetition" of a HIIT exercise is 20 seconds of pushing on your own to near-breathless, complied with by 10 seconds of recuperation. This is repeated for a total of 8 repeatings in a given exercise.

Research studies have revealed that HIIT increases fat melting greater than continuous cardio exercise, and it also assists you build muscular tissue quicker. But there are some crucial things to remember when starting a HIIT workout, like appropriate technique and ample warm-up.

When done poorly, HIIT exercises can cause injuries such as tendonitis or muscle mass tears. Therefore, you ought to constantly start your exercise with a 5-minute warm-up prior to moving right into a HIIT routine. It's additionally suggested to obtain the approval of your medical professional or physical therapist prior to beginning any kind of kind of HIIT program. They can give you with assistance and reliable options to match your health and wellness demands.

2. Cycling
Biking burns a substantial amount of calories, yet it also develops muscle-- particularly in your legs and core. This aids you reduce weight and construct a leaner body, because muscular tissue is much more metabolically energetic than fat and burns more calories even when at rest.

Whether you're riding outdoors or in a health club, cycling is a flexible exercise that can be scaled to your physical fitness degree and lifestyle. You can go all out for a high-intensity period training session, or you can pedal slowly for a far away adventure. Cycling is likewise a great choice for individuals with joint issues, as it's low-impact.

You can also include selection to your bike routine by integrating toughness training into your workouts. You can either do this on days you do not cycle or in between cycles. A mix of both cardio and strength work is best, ACE advises. For example, do an HIIT bike trip where you cycle as difficult as you can versus a high resistance for 30 to 60 seconds and after that recoup with a couple of minutes of simple pedaling. Do this two to three times a week for a hectic, total-body fat-burning exercise. In a small study in the journal Flow, bikers that performed HIIT bike trips two times a week shed more body fat than those who only cycled at a moderate strength.

3. Toughness Training
Strength training helps develop lean muscular tissue mass, which can aid melt more calories both during exercise and after. When you're trying to slim down, nonetheless, you might intend to take a more conservative method to stamina training. Mikuriya suggests staying clear of too many consecutive sessions and keeping workouts short and to the point.

She suggests starting with a solitary collection of each workout (at the very least 8 to 12 reps) performed at a weight that tires your muscle mass after regarding 10 repeatings and gradually increasing your reps and weight as you gain strength. It's likewise crucial to alter your routine frequently to avoid your body from adapting to exercises and keep your muscle mass shedding.

If you do not have accessibility to a fitness center or standard health and fitness tools do not worry. You can still get a great fat-burning workout with your own bodyweight and simple home products like a chair, canteen or tinned foods. Try a fundamental full-body routine that mixes resistance and cardio, such as squats, lunges and push-ups.
